You are viewing an old version of this page. View the current version.

Compare with Current View Page History

« Previous Version 4 Next »

Genel Bölümü'nde, "Kayıt/Kullanıcı İşlemleri" menüsünün altında yer alır. Kullanıcılara kolon bazında kısıtlama verilmesini sağlayan bölümdür. Kullanıcılar, kısıta uygun olmayan bir kayıt girmeye çalıştıkları zaman program tarafından işleme izin verilmeyerek uyarı verilir.

Bu bölüm, veritabanının Oracle olması ve Yardımcı Programlar → Şirket-Şube Parametre Tanımları → Parametreler → “Kolon Bazında Geçerlilik Sistemi” veya “Hepsi” seçeneğinin işaretlenmesi ile aktif hale gelir.



Kolon Bazında Geçerlilik Değerleri Ekranı
Kısıt Kapsamı

Kolon bazında yapılacak kısıtlamanın geçerli olacağı kullanıcı yada kullanıcıların belirlendiği alandır. Alanın sağ tarafında yer alan aşağı ok butonu ile seçim yapılır. Tüm Kullanıcılar, Grup ve Kullanıcı seçeneklerinden oluşur.

Kullanıcı Kodu

"Kısıt Kapsamı" alanında "Kullanıcılar" seçeneğinin seçilmesi ile aktif hale gelen alandır. Kısıt yapılacak kullanıcı kodunun girilmesini sağlar. Rehber butonu  ile, kullanıcı kodları arasından seçim yapılır.

Grup Kodu

Kısıt Kapsamı" alanında "Grup" seçeneğinin seçilmesi ile aktif hale gelen alandır. Kısıt yapılacak grup kodunun girilmesini sağlar. Rehber butonu  ile, grup kodları arasından seçim yapılır. 

Veritabanı Nesnesi

Kolon bazı kısıtlamaların geçerli olacağı tablonun seçildiği alandır. Alanın sağ tarafında yer alan aşağı ok butonu ile tablo seçenekleri arasından seçim yapılır. 

Örneğin;

"Stok Hareket Kayıtları" bölümündeki bir alan için kısıtlama yapılacaksa TBLSTHAR seçeneğinin seçilmesi gerekir.

Saha Adı

"Veritabanı Nesnesi" alanında tablo adı seçilmesi halinde, bu tablonun hangi sahasına ait kısıtlamanın raporu alınması isteniyorsa, ilgili saha adının seçildiği alandır. Alanın sağ tarafında yer alan aşağı ok butonu ile, ilgili saha seçilir.

"Saha Adı" alanının altındaki boş alanda ise kısıtlamanın hangi alan için yapılacağına dair SQL cümlesi yazılır.

Silme Kontrolü 

Kolon Bazı Geçerlilik uygulamasında verilen kısıta uymayan kayıtların kullanıcı tarafından silinmesinin engellenmesini sağlayan seçenektir. Kullanıcı yada kullanıcı grubunun verilen kısıta uygun olmayan kayıtları girmesine izin verilmeyeceği gibi, seçeneğin işaretlenmesi ile - kısıt kapsamı dışındaki bir kullanıcı tarafından kısıta aykırı bir kayıt girildiyse - kısıt kapsamındaki kullanıcı, kısıt dışı kaydı silmesine de izin verilmeyecektir.